Tractor Transportation as an Oversized Load: Key Features
When you need to move a tractor from point A to point B, even over a relatively short distance, driving it on public roads is rarely a practical option. Tracked tractors are prohibited from using public roads because they can damage the asphalt. Driving large wheeled tractors over long distances is also inconvenient, often unsafe, and impractical due to wear on the running gear. That is why this type of equipment is usually transported on lowboy trailers.
Like most agricultural machinery, tractors are considered oversized cargo in logistics. They typically require special permits, route approval, and, in many cases, escort vehicles. Since tractors are also high-value equipment, protecting them from damage during transportation is essential.
Types of Transport Used for Tractor Shipping (Lowboy Trailer, Tractor Unit, Platform)
There are several ways to transport a tractor. The most common options include:
- Lowboy trailer. The most popular solution. Suitable for most tractors, from compact models to heavy tracked machines.
- High-powered tractor unit with a platform trailer. A convenient option for smaller and lighter tractors. The platform may be open or have side walls, but additional securing equipment is always required for safe transport.
- Extendable (telescopic) platform. Used for particularly wide and/or tall machinery or when transporting several machines in a single trip. This option is cost-effective but requires additional permits.
The choice of transport directly affects the shipping cost. For example, a lowboy trailer is more expensive than a standard platform but provides safer transportation. Every transport solution is selected based on the cargo’s weight, dimensions, and delivery timeframe.
How Tractor Transportation Costs Are Calculated
The cost of transporting tractors across Ukraine depends primarily on the distance between the pickup and delivery points and the freight rate per kilometer. The final price may also include:
- transport dispatch to the loading location;
- waiting time during loading or unloading (if the process takes longer than expected);
- permits for oversized cargo transportation;
- escort vehicles, if required;
- cargo insurance.

Factors Affecting Transportation Costs
| Factor | Impact on Cost |
| Equipment dimensions and weight | Heavier and wider machinery requires more fuel and additional permits |
| Seasonality | Demand for agricultural equipment transport increases during planting and harvesting seasons, resulting in higher rates |
| Escort requirements | If the platform exceeds 3.5 m in width or 24 m in length, escort vehicles are mandatory |
| Road conditions | Challenging intercity routes using secondary roads increase travel time and equipment wear |

Required Documents for Tractor Transportation
Now let’s look at the documents required for tractor transportation. They fall into two categories: documents for the vehicle itself and cargo shipping documents.
Mandatory documents include:
- transportation agreement;
- consignment note;
- invoice;
- route sheet;
- tractor registration certificate;
- insurance policy.
For machinery imported from abroad, customs declarations and relevant certificates are also required.
Permits for Oversized and Heavy Cargo Transportation
Permits issued by Ukravtodor and the National Police are mandatory for the legal transportation of oversized agricultural machinery. These permits are issued after the route has been approved. Without them, you risk substantial fines and, in the event of an accident, potential criminal liability.

Preparing a Tractor for Transportation
Before loading, the tractor is washed, excess fuel is drained to a safe minimum level, and any attachments are either removed or securely fastened. Tire pressure is checked, while the cab and windows are typically protected with film. All moving components—such as booms, buckets, and towing mechanisms—are firmly secured with chains or straps to prevent movement during transport.
